Ill tourists 'not carrying bird flu virus'

Tests have confirmed that three people on the French Indian Ocean island of La Reunion are not carrying the deadly H5N1 strain of bird flu, as first feared, the Health Ministry said today.

Two people tested negative today in follow-up examinations by the Pasteur Institute in Paris.

The third person, a 43-year-old man, was determined not to be carrying the illness yesterday, the ministry said.
